> Support loading alternative docker client config from system environment

> When using YARN docker support, although the hadoop shell supported
> {code:java}
> -docker_client_config{code}
> to pass the client config file that contains security token to generate the
> docker config for each job as a temporary file.
> For other applications that submit jobs to YARN, e.g. Spark, which loads the
> docker setting via system environment e.g.
> {code:java}
> spark.executorEnv.* {code}
> will not be able to add those authorization token because this system
> environment isn't considered in YARN.
> Add genetic solution to handle these kind of cases without making changes in
> spark code or others
